diff options
author | Alex Yatskov <alex@foosoft.net> | 2016-04-24 16:48:30 -0700 |
---|---|---|
committer | Alex Yatskov <alex@foosoft.net> | 2016-04-24 16:48:30 -0700 |
commit | 8143e372cdb61012ec8683feb01688adfa39dde1 (patch) | |
tree | e7336df5bd9fd3bb676e5063d649c5dd8b83fee3 /ext/fg/js/frame.js | |
parent | 59989cd78c60b4c8d089b3bed070b11eb62622b6 (diff) |
Stub handler for kanji click
Diffstat (limited to 'ext/fg/js/frame.js')
-rw-r--r-- | ext/fg/js/frame.js | 14 |
1 files changed, 14 insertions, 0 deletions
diff --git a/ext/fg/js/frame.js b/ext/fg/js/frame.js index 868f07ce..c8f8211e 100644 --- a/ext/fg/js/frame.js +++ b/ext/fg/js/frame.js @@ -17,3 +17,17 @@ */ +function onKanjiQuery(kanji) { + alert(kanji); +} + +function registerKanjiLinks() { + for (const link of [].slice.call(document.getElementsByClassName('kanji-link'))) { + link.addEventListener('click', (e) => { + e.preventDefault(); + onKanjiQuery(e.target.innerHTML); + }); + } +} + +document.addEventListener('DOMContentLoaded', registerKanjiLinks, false); |